The Fixed Point Approach to the Stability of Fractional Differential Equations with Causal Operators

摘要

In this paper, the Hyers-Ulam (HU) stability and Hyers-Ulam-Rassias (HUR) stability of fractional differential equations with causal operators (FDEwCO) are investigated. The techniques rely on a fixed point theorem which is employed to study the HUR stability for FDEwCO on both bounded and unbounded time intervals as well as HU stability on bounded time interval. Finally, two typical examples are given to demonstrate the applications of theoretical results proposed.
机译:本文研究了具有因果算子(FDEwCO)的分数阶微分方程的Hyers-Ulam(HU)稳定性和Hyers-Ulam-Rassias(HUR)稳定性。该技术依赖于定点定理,该定理用于研究FDEwCO在有界和无界时间间隔上的HUR稳定性,以及在有界时间间隔上的HU稳定性。最后,给出两个典型的例子来说明所提出的理论结果的应用。
